As a previous "shooter" I know that slumps happen, especially mid season. When they do, you have to take a step back, stop forcing it, and shoot what is open. It also helps to bring the ball down a little bit in your shot motion to get a lower release point, which helps overcome the dead legs.
He'll pick it back up before season ends. Question is will it be soon enough to matter for the post season.....
